(5K10.48) Current Coupled Pendula
$0.00
Two coils are connected in series through banana cables. An extremely strong magnet is set to oscillate in one of the coils. This induces a current in both coils, because they are in series. This causes the other coil to produce a magnetic field that causes the other magnet to oscillate at the same frequency.
